Subaru Reveals 2025 Forester SUV
Revealed at the 2023 LA Auto Show, the 2025 Forester comes in several trim levels, with pricing to be announced in spring 2024.

The 2025 Toyota Camry will be an exclusively hybrid-electric vehicle with a standard 225 net combined horsepower on Front Wheel Drive (FWD) models and 232 horsepower on Electronic On-Demand All-Wheel Drive (AWD) equipped models.

Pickups, SUVs, and vans with a hood height greater than 40 inches are about 45% more likely to cause fatalities in pedestrian crashes, according to the IIHS.
